“Праця, оптимізм, постійне, самовдосконалення - запорука життєвого успіху”

Показ дописів із міткою 8 клас. Показати всі дописи
Показ дописів із міткою 8 клас. Показати всі дописи

вівторок, 27 лютого 2018 р.

Графічне відображення даних

Графічне відображення даних мовами програмування
Проект "Стовпчаста діаграма" """ import tkinter from tkinter import ttk from tkinter import messagebox main = tkinter.Tk() main.wm_title('Стовпчаста діаграма') # оголошення списку значень data = [15, 50, 70, 25, 10, 30] # створення полотна для малювання та розміщення на головній формі cnv = tkinter.Canvas(main, width=200, height=100) cnv.pack() # команди для малювання на полотні - створення графічного примітиву: прямокутника cnv.create_rectangle(0, 100, 200, 100) i = 0 d_list = len(data) while i < d_list: cnv.create_rectangle(10 + i * 30, 100, 30 + i * 30, 100 - data[i], fill='yellow') i += 1 #запуск опрацювання подій програми main.mainloop()

вівторок, 20 лютого 2018 р.

Складання та реалізація алгоритмів із циклом з лічильником у середовищі програмування

  • Вправа 1. Розробіть у середовищі програмування мовою програмування Python проект, за допомогою якого можна визначити, скільки слів введено в текстове поле, якщо відомо, що між словами міститься лише один пропуск. 
  1. У середовищі програмування мовою Python створіть новий файл з іменем Кількість слів.
  2. В області програмного коду запишіть команди за зразком:
  3. import tkinter
    from tkinter import ttk
    from tkinter import messagebox
    main = tkinter.Tk()
    main.title('Кількість слів у реченні')
    
    # створення об'єкта для отримання значення з текстового поля: Введіть речення
    row_var = tkinter.StringVar()
    
    # опрацювання події натиснення кнопки
    def button_click():
        # початкові дані: s - кількість слів (спочатку дорівнює нулю), z - рядок, що складається з одного пропуску
        s = 0
        z = ' '
        # отримання значення введеного рядка і присвоєння змінній st  
        st = row_var.get()
        # визначення довжини рядка
        k = len(st)
        # проходимо за допомогою циклу від початку рядка до кінця, фіксуючи кожне слово, якщо зустрінемо пропуск 
        for i in range(0, k):
            if st[i] == z:
                s = s + 1 # s++
        # виведення повідомлення про кількість слів у реченні
        tkinter.messagebox.showinfo('Результат', str(s+1))
            
    #створення текстового напису Введіть речення та його розміщення на головній формі
    label = tkinter.Label(text='Введіть речення')
    label.pack()
    
    #створення текстового поля Введіть речення та його розміщення на головній формі
    edit = tkinter.Entry(main, textvariable=row_var)
    edit.pack()
    
    #створення кнопки та розміщення об'єкта на головній формі
    button = tkinter.Button(main, text='Визначити', command=button_click)
    button.pack()
    
    #запуск опрацювання подій програми
    main.mainloop()
Відео Оксани Пасічник
Додатковий матеріал 

четвер, 26 жовтня 2017 р.

неділя, 10 вересня 2017 р.

Кодування символів

1.Пройти тест http://testinform.in.ua/test-1-8-klas-koduvannya-danix/

2. Допоміжні веб-ресурси:



1. Онлайновий ресурс для генерування QR кодів http://ua.qr-code-generator.com/
2. Програма для розпізнавання QR кодів онлайн http://www.imgonline.com.ua/scan-qr-bar-code.php
3. Програми для розпізнавання QR кодів, що встановлюються на мобільні пристрої http://qrcoder.ru/soft.html або https://play.google.com/store/apps/details?id=la.droid.qr&hl=uk
4. Таблиця символів ASCII https://support.office.com/uk-ua/article/%D0%A2%D0%B0%D0%B1%D0%BB%D0%B8%D1%86%D1%8F-%D1%81%D0%B8%D0%BC%D0%B2%D0%BE%D0%BB%D1%96%D0%B2-ASCII-d13f58d3-7bcb-44a7-a4d5-972ee12e50e0 або https://uk.wikipedia.org/wiki/ASCII
5. Таблиця символів  Windows-1251     https://uk.wikipedia.org/wiki/Windows-1251
6. Таблиця символів Unicode http://unicode-table.com/ru/#control-character

Завдання:

1.У власній структурі папок створіть папку Кодування.
2.Завантажити документ 
 Тексти на свій комп'ютер.

3.Виконати  вправу 2, с.10.
4.Зберегти файл у власній  папці.

пʼятниця, 2 червня 2017 р.

STEM-фестиваль-2017

1 червня з учнями 8 класу: Гладь Танею та Машталяр Ярославом, взяли активну участь у STEM-фестивалі, організований викладачами та студентами фізико-математичного факультету ТНПУ ім.В.Гнатюка. 
Щиро вдячні організаторам за креативний, позитивний захід.

Програмне рішення

  Опублікувати покликання створеного власного блогу (програмного рішення) на віртуальнній стіні.